🪙 Roman Provincial, Caesarea, Tiberius, 33-34 C.E., Silver Drachma
This silver drachma, minted between 33-34 C.E. during the reign of Tiberius, originates from the provincial mint of Caesarea in Cappadocia (modern-day Kayseri, Turkey). This coin is particularly significant as a “Christ lifetime issue,” struck during the period traditionally associated with the life and crucifixion of Jesus Christ.
Obverse: The obverse side features a laureate head of Emperor Tiberius, with the inscription “TI CAES AVG P M TR P XXXV,” which stands for Tiberius Caesar Augustus, Pontifex Maximus, Tribunicia Potestas (35th time). Tiberius, the second Roman emperor, ruled from 14 to 37 C.E. His portrait on the coin signifies his authority and the continuation of the Julio-Claudian dynasty. The laurel wreath symbolizes victory and honor, reinforcing his status as emperor.
Reverse: The reverse side depicts the bare head of Drusus the Younger, with the inscription “DRVSVS CAES TI AVG F COS II TR P,” indicating Drusus Caesar, son of Tiberius, Consul for the second time, Tribune of the People. Drusus the Younger, the son of Tiberius, was a prominent figure in the Julio-Claudian dynasty but died prematurely in 23 C.E. His inclusion on the coin underscores the dynastic aspirations and the importance of lineage in Roman imperial propaganda.
Historical Context: This silver drachma weighs 3.1 grams and measures 17 mm in diameter. It was struck at the Caesarea mint in Cappadocia, a key region in Asia Minor under Roman control.
